RAID 0: Die Grundlagen und Vorteile der Datenstreifung erklärt

RAID 0: Leistung und Eignung im Diskussionsfokus

Willkommen zu unserem tiefgehenden Einblick in die Welt der RAID-Levels, insbesondere RAID 0. RAID-Systeme spielen eine wesentliche Rolle bei der Optimierung der Speicherlösungen in modernen Datenumgebungen. Während einige RAID-Levels auf Redundanz und Datensicherheit setzen, sticht RAID 0 durch seinen Fokus auf Leistung hervor. Doch was bedeutet das in der Praxis? In diesem Artikel werden wir auf die Funktionsweise, Vorteile und auch die typischen Einsatzszenarien von RAID 0 eingehen und einen kurzen Überblick über weitere gängige RAID-Level geben. Dieser Artikel richtet sich an alle, die die Feinheiten von RAID-Systemen verstehen und die bestmögliche Speicherlösung für ihre Bedürfnisse finden möchten.

Inhaltsverzeichnis

RAID-Levels erklärt

RAID steht für “Redundant Array of Independent Disks” und stellt eine Technologie dar, die mehrere physische Festplatten zu einer größeren logischen Einheit zusammenfasst. Diese Technik wird aus verschiedenen Gründen eingesetzt, beispielsweise um die Verarbeitungsgeschwindigkeit der Daten oder die Fehlertoleranz zu verbessern. Unterschiedliche RAID-Levels bieten diverse Kombinationen aus Redundanz und Leistung, um den unterschiedlichen Anforderungen von Benutzern und Anwendungen gerecht zu werden.

Variationen der RAID-Levels wie RAID 0, 1, 5, und 10 sind besonders häufig implementiert, wobei jede dieser Varianten ihre spezifischen Stärken und Schwächen hat. So vereint RAID 0 beispielsweise mehrere Festplatten zu einem einzigen Volume ohne Datenredundanz, um die Geschwindigkeit zu maximieren. In der Kontrastierung dazu steht RAID 1, das Daten durch Spiegelung sichert, aber keine Leistungssteigerung bietet. Die Kenntnis der Unterschiede zwischen diesen Levels ist essentiell, um das passende RAID-System entsprechend der individuellen Bedürfnisse und Budgetrestriktionen zu wählen.

RAID-Level können auf verschiedene Weise Datenredundanz, optimierte Leistung und Data Protection in Festplattensystemen gewährleisten. Admins sollten die Unterschiede kennen.

Administratoren von Speichersystemen sehen sich häufig mit der Wahl des geeigneten RAID-Levels konfrontiert. Die verschiedenen RAID-Levels bieten eine Palette von Möglichkeiten zur Verwaltung von Datenredundanz, Leistungsoptimierung und Datenschutz in Festplattensystemen. Diese Systeme sind darauf ausgelegt, Festplatten entweder schneller, sicherer oder eine Kombination aus beidem zu machen. RAID-Levels wie 1, 5 und 10 sind speziell darauf ausgelegt, einen Ausgleich zwischen Geschwindigkeit und Datensicherheit zu bieten.

Jedes RAID-Level hat spezifische Einsatzgebiete und Anforderungen. Beispielsweise bietet RAID 0 die höchste Schreib- und Lesegeschwindigkeit, da es Daten über mehrere Festplatten streift, allerdings auf Kosten jeglicher Redundanz. Ein Ausfall einer einzigen Festplatte kann hier den Verlust aller Daten bedeuten. Im Gegensatz dazu stellt RAID 5 sicher, dass auch im Falle eines Laufwerksausfalls keine Daten verloren gehen. Die Wahl von RAID-Levels sollte daher sorgfältig in Abstimmung mit den spezifischen Anforderungen der jeweiligen IT-Infrastruktur erfolgen.

Was ist RAID 0?

RAID 0, oft als Striping bekannt, ist eine Konfiguration, die Daten gleichmäßig über zwei oder mehr Festplatten verteilt, um eine maximale Leistung im Lesefluss und Schreibprozess zu erzielen. Es bietet keine Redundanz—wenn eine einzelne Festplatte ausfällt, geht das gesamte Array verloren. Dennoch wird RAID 0 aufgrund seiner Geschwindigkeitsvorteile häufig in Anwendungen eingesetzt, in denen die Performance im Vordergrund steht, wie zum Beispiel bei Video-Streaming oder in Anwendungsumgebungen, die große Datenmengen in Echtzeit verarbeiten müssen.

Der Vorteil von RAID 0 liegt in seiner Fähigkeit, die Gesamtkapazität aller Festplatten zu einer schnellen Einheit zusammenzuführen, um so die Datentransferraten dramatisch zu verbessern. Dabei ist allerdings zu beachten, dass RAID 0 keinerlei Fehlertoleranz bietet, was bedeutet, dass jede enthaltene Festplatte einen potenziellen Single Point of Failure darstellt. Nutzer sollten RAID 0 daher nur in Szenarien erwägen, in denen hohe Lese- und Schreibgeschwindigkeiten entscheidend und Datensicherheit weniger wichtig ist.

Das Funktionsprinzip von RAID 0 im Schaubild

Im Kern basiert das Funktionsprinzip von RAID 0 auf einem Expansionsprozess, bei dem Datenblöcke zerlegt und gleichmäßig über die beteiligten Festplatten verteilt werden—dies erfolgt ohne ein Paritätsbit oder eine redundante Sicherung. Diese Methode der Datenverteilung wird als Striping beschrieben, weil die Daten über “Streifen” hinweg auf die Festplatten verteilt werden. Das Ergebnis ist eine erhebliche Erhöhung der Lesegeschwindigkeit, da bei Simultananfragen alle Festplatten parallel aufgerufen werden.

Um die Vorteile von RAID 0 vollständig zu verstehen, ist eine visuelle Darstellung hilfreich, um zu demonstrieren, wie die Datenverteilung arbeitet. Bei einem einfachen RAID-0-Szenario mit zwei Festplatten wird Block A auf die erste Festplatte und Block B auf die zweite Festplatte geschrieben. Dadurch ist es möglich, anstelle von sequentiellen Schreib-Lesevorgängen parallele Abläufe durchzuführen, was zu einer erheblichen Senkung der Zugriffszeiten führt. Diese Verteilung ist jedoch der Hauptgrund für das Fehlen einer Fehlertoleranz bei RAID 0.

Die Vor- und Nachteile von RAID 0 im Überblick

RAID 0 bietet eine unschlagbare Kombination aus Geschwindigkeitsvorteilen und der maximalen Nutzung der gesamten Festplattenkapazität. Eine zentrale Stärke ist die herausragende Lesegeschwindigkeit durch die gleichzeitige Nutzung aller in das Array eingebundenen Festplatten. Diese erhöht nicht nur die Datenraten, sondern verbessert insgesamt die Leistung bei datenzentrierten Aufgaben oder Anwendungen drastisch.

Aber wie bei jeder Technologie gibt es auch erhebliche Nachteile. Der wichtigste ist das komplette Fehlen von Datenredundanz—fällt eine Festplatte aus, sind alle darin enthaltenen Daten verloren. RAID 0 erfordert deshalb eine gewissenhafte Backup-Strategie, um Datenverlust vorzubeugen. Da viele Nutzer die Geschwindigkeit schätzen, allerdings hohe Ansprüche an die Datensicherheit haben, eignet sich RAID 0 in der Regel nicht für Business-Anwendungen, sondern eher für den Einsatz in nicht-kritischen oder schnell wiederherstellbaren Umgebungen.

Was sind typische Einsatzszenarien für RAID-0-Systeme?

RAID 0 findet vor allem in Anwendungen mit hohen Anforderungen an die Geschwindigkeit und großen Datenvolumen Einsatz. Beispielsweise werden in der Videobearbeitung oder beim hochauflösenden Audio-Editing große Dateien verarbeitet, deren Lade- und Bearbeitungszeiten durch RAID 0 signifikant reduziert werden können. Dies erzeugt gerade in kreativen Berufen, bei denen permanente Effizienzsteigerung gefragt ist, eine enorme Attraktivität.

Zudem werden RAID-0-Systeme häufig in Computerspielen und bei der Bearbeitung großer Datenbanken eingesetzt. Diese Szenarien profitieren von den schnellen Leseschreibvorgängen und der vollständigen Nutzung der Platte, und können ihre BI- und Reporting-Performance verbessern. Allerdings sollte immer berücksichtigt werden, dass RAID 0 nicht für Systeme empfohlen wird, bei denen Datenverlust ein großes Problem darstellt.

Welche weiteren gängigen RAID-Level gibt es?

RAID 3: Paritätsfestplatte

RAID 3 nutzt eine spezielle Paritätsplatte, um Daten zu speichern, was bedeutet, dass es sowohl hohe Leistung als auch Datenintegrität bietet. Diese Konfiguration ist durch die Streifenbildung auf Byte-Ebene charakterisiert, wobei ein zusätzliches Laufwerk für die Paritätsdaten verwendet wird. Das Ergebnis ist ein System, das Fehler erkennen und korrigieren kann, indem es die Paritätsdaten nutzt.

In realen Szenarien wird RAID 3 oft in Umgebungen verwendet, die sequentielle Datenoperationen, wie Video- oder Streamingdienste, durchführen müssen. Diese Anwendungen profitieren von einer hohen Datenübertragungsrate durch die parallele Datenverteilung über mehrere Festplatten und der Fehlerkorrektur über die Paritätsfestplatte. Die Überwachung und Implementierung von RAID 3 kann jedoch aufgrund des Bedarfs einer dedizierten Paritätsfestplatte komplexer und kostspieliger sein.

RAID 5: Alle wichtigen Informationen zu dem RAID-Level

RAID 5 erfreut sich in vielen Unternehmensumgebungen großer Beliebtheit, weil es eine ausgewogene Mischung aus Performance, Speicherplatz-Ausnutzung und Datensicherheit bietet. Bei RAID 5 werden die Daten und Paritätsinformationen so auf drei oder mehr Festplatten verteilt, dass jederzeit ein Wiederaufbau der Daten bei Ausfall einer Festplatte möglich ist, ohne dass die Leistung maßgeblich beeinträchtigt wird.

Da es keine dedizierte Paritätsplatte gibt, werden Paritätsinformationen über alle Laufwerke verteilt, was diesen Level besonders effizient macht. RAID 5 ist ideal für lesefreudige Datenbanklösungen und Webserver, da es eine gute Balance aus Geschwindigkeit und Datensicherheit bietet. Allerdings kann der Wiederherstellungsprozess im Falle eines Festplattendefekts langsamer sein, da die fehlenden Daten rekonstruiert werden müssen.

RAID 6: Der Festplattenverbund mit hoher Ausfallsicherheit

RAID 6 geht noch einen Schritt weiter als RAID 5, indem es doppelte Paritätsinformationen verwendet. Diese Erweiterung bedeuted, dass ein RAID-6-System den gleichzeitigen Ausfall von bis zu zwei Festplatten verkraften kann, wodurch eine extrem hohe Datenverfügbarkeit und -integrität gewährleistet wird. Dies macht RAID 6 ideal für geschäftskritische Anwendungen, bei denen hohe Sicherheit im Vordergrund steht.

Dieses Level erfordert jedoch mindestens vier Festplatten und der damit verbundene Overhead kann die Leistung bei Schreiboperationen beeinflussen. RAID 6 wird häufig in großen Speicher-Arrays eingesetzt, bei denen die Hauptpriorität auf Datenerhalt und Verfügbarkeit liegt, selbst wenn mehrere Laufwerksausfälle auftreten. Nutzer sollten dies jedoch mit den gegebenen Leistungsanforderungen abgleichen, um sicherzugehen, dass RAID 6 das richtige Level für ihre Zwecke ist.

RAID 10: Die RAID-Kombination aus Spiegelung und Striping

RAID 10 kombiniert die besten Aspekte von RAID 0 und RAID 1, indem es sowohl Daten striping und spiegeln durchführt. Dies bedeutet, dass es die Lesegeschwindigkeit von RAID 0 mit der Datensicherheit von RAID 1 kombiniert. RAID 10 erfordert mindestens vier Festplatten und bietet sowohl hohe Leistung als auch eine robuste Redundanz, was es zu einer bevorzugten Wahl für geschäftskritische Anwendungen macht.

Dieser Level ist besonders nützlich für Schreibzugriffe, weil er schnell ist und gleichzeitig sicherstellt, dass Daten im Falle eines Ausfalls eines Laufwerks nicht verloren gehen. RAID 10 ist optimal für Datenbank-Server und Anwendungen, bei denen sowohl ein schneller Datenfluss als auch eine hohe Datensicherheit erforderlich sind. Allerdings ist der Aspekt der Kosten zu berücksichtigen, da man auf die Hälfte der Festplattenkapazität aufgrund des Spiegelungsprozesses verzichtet.

Passende Produkte

Es gibt etliche Hardwarelösungen und Softwareoptionen, die RAID-Konfigurationen unterstützen. Viele moderne NAS-Systeme (Network Attached Storage) bieten integrierte Unterstützung für RAID 0 bis 10, was die Konfiguration und Verwaltung erheblich erleichtert. Produktempfehlungen variieren je nach speziellen Anforderungen wie Speicherkapazität oder Performance-Bedarf. Populäre Marken und Modelle sollten auf ihre spezifischen Funktionen und Kompatibilitäten geprüft werden, um eine fundierte Entscheidung zu treffen.

Softwarelösungen bieten oft zusätzliche Flexibilität, insbesondere für personalisierte RAID-Setups. Tools wie mdadm für Linux oder integrierte Windows-RAID-Optionen unterstützen eine breite Palette von RAID-Levels. Diese Lösungen ermöglichen eine einfachere Verwaltung und sind oft kostengünstiger als Hardwarelösungen, lassen jedoch bei der Leistung und der Robustheit manchmal zu wünschen übrig.

Ähnliche Artikel

Cloud-Speicher im Vergleich: Die besten 9 Cloud-Anbieter im Überblick

In der digitalen Ära ist effektives Datenmanagement entscheidend. Cloud-Speicherlösungen bieten eine flexible und skalierbare Möglichkeit, um Speicherkapazität zu erweitern und Daten von überall aus zugänglich zu machen. Dieser Artikel bietet einen umfassenden Vergleich der besten Cloud-Anbieter auf dem Markt und hilft Ihnen, den Dienst zu finden, der am besten zu Ihren Anforderungen passt.

Backup mit tar erstellen: So funktioniert die Archivierung

Datensicherheit sollte in keinem Unternehmen vernachlässigt werden. Ein Backup mit tar ermöglicht eine einfache und effektive Methode, um wichtige Daten zu archivieren und zu schützen. In diesem Artikel zeigen wir Ihnen Schritt für Schritt, wie Sie ein tar-Datei-Backup erstellen und es für zukünftige Einsätze verwenden können. Dies umfasst Beispiele und Tipps zur Optimierung Ihrer Backup-Strategie.

Nächste Schritte

Thema Wichtige Punkte
RAID 0 Maximale Geschwindigkeit durch Datenstriping, keine Redundanz oder Fehlertoleranz.
RAID 3 Datensicherung durch eine dedizierte Paritätsplatte.
RAID 5 Zwischenlösung für Performance und Datensicherheit; Parität über alle Festplatten verteilt.
RAID 6 Hohe Fehlertoleranz durch doppelte Parität, geeignet für kritische Anwendungen.
RAID 10 Kombiniert Striping und Spiegelung für hohe Leistung und Datensicherheit.
Hardware & Software Lösungen NAS-Systeme und Softwaretools wie mdadm bieten Unterstützung für verschiedene RAID-Level.

FAQ

Was ist Raid Level 0?

RAID Level 0, auch bekannt als “Striping”, ist eine Methode zur Speicherung von Daten auf mehreren Festplatten. Dabei werden die Daten in Blöcke aufgeteilt und abwechselnd über alle Festplatten verteilt. Das Hauptziel von RAID 0 ist es, die Datentransferrate und Gesamtleistung zu erhöhen, da mehrere Festplatten gleichzeitig auf Daten zugreifen können. Ein wichtiger Punkt ist, dass RAID 0 keine Fehlertoleranz bietet. Wenn eine der Festplatten ausfällt, können alle darauf gespeicherten Daten verloren gehen. Daher sollte RAID 0 nur in Anwendungen verwendet werden, bei denen Geschwindigkeit wichtiger ist als Datensicherheit.

Wann ist RAID 0 sinnvoll?

RAID 0 ist sinnvoll, wenn du die maximale Geschwindigkeit und Leistung für Lese- und Schreibvorgänge benötigst und dir die Datensicherheit nicht so wichtig ist. Es verteilt die Daten gleichmäßig auf mehrere Festplatten, wodurch die Daten schneller verarbeitet werden können. RAID 0 bietet keinen Schutz vor Ausfällen, da bei einem Festplattendefekt alle Daten verloren gehen. Es eignet sich daher gut für Situationen, in denen Geschwindigkeit entscheidend ist, wie z.B. beim Videoschnitt oder bei Anwendungen, die hohe Datenraten erfordern, und die Daten entweder gesichert werden oder nicht kritisch sind.

Wie viele Platten dürfen bei RAID 0 ausfallen?

Bei RAID 0 darf keine Platte ausfallen. Wenn eine Platte ausfällt, gehen die Daten verloren, da die Informationen gleichmäßig auf alle Platten verteilt sind und keine Redundanz vorhanden ist.

Was ist schneller, RAID 0 oder Raid 1?

RAID 0 ist normalerweise schneller als RAID 1. Das liegt daran, dass RAID 0 Daten auf mehrere Festplatten verteilt (Striping), was die Lese- und Schreibgeschwindigkeit erhöht. RAID 1 hingegen speichert die gleichen Daten auf zwei Festplatten (Mirroring), was die Datensicherheit verbessert, aber nicht die Geschwindigkeit erhöht.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top